Goblin Valley State Park, Utah

  During the summertime months at Goblin Valley State Park temperatures are generally in the 90's with nighttime lows in the 60's. The winter brings highs down to the 30's, and overnight lows at Goblin Valley State Park throughout the wintertime regularly dip into the 0's.
